Q1: At what age can a kid safely utilize a bunk bed?
A1: Generally, children aged six and older are considered safe to use the upper bunk due to the height and stability aspects included.
Q2: Can I position a bunk bed near a window?
A2: It is a good idea to prevent positioning a bunk bed near windows to decrease the threat of falling or injuries.
Q3: Are bunk beds safe for younger children?
A3: While some modern bunk beds include safety features accommodating more youthful kids, it is usually recommended to wait till they are older, usually over six years.
Q4: What is the typical weight limit for leading bunks?
A4: Weight limits vary by model but typically range from 150 to 250 pounds. Constantly refer to the maker's specifications.
Q5: How typically should I check the bunk bed's security functions?
A5: It is suggested to carry out a safety check every couple of months or whenever you observe any signs of wear.
